Write a note on the ‘reduction of nitro benzene under different conditions.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

(i) Strongly Acidic Medium : When reduced with tin and hydrochloric acid, aromatic nitro compounds are converted to aryl amines.
`{:(C_6H_5NO_2+6[H]underset(Fe"/"con.HCl)overset(Sn"/"con.HCl)(to)C_6H_5NH_2+2H_2O),(" Aniline "):}`
(ii) Neutral Medium : When reduced with a neurtal, reducing agents like zinc dust and aqueous ammonium chloride, aromatic nitro compounds form aryl hydroxylamines.
`{:(C_6H_5NO_2+4[H]overset(Zn"/"NH_4Cl)(to)C_6H_5NHOH+H_2O),(" Phenyl hydroxylamine "):}`
(iii) Alkaline Medium : In alkaline medium, Nitro benzene on reduction forms the intermediate products nitrosobenzene `(C_6H_5NO)` and phenyl hydroxylamine `(C_6H_5NHOH)`. These undergo bimolecular condensation reactinon. According to the appropriate reducing agent in alkaline medium different products are obtained.

(iv) Catalytic Reduction : Lithium Aluminium hydride is a powerful hydride ion donor. So it reduces nitro benzene to Aniline. This reduction can also be carried out by `H_2"/"Ni`.
`C_6H_5NO_2overset(LiAlH_4)(to)C_6H_5NH_2[" Aniline "]`
`C_6H_5NO_2underset(" Catalytic hydrogenation ")overset(H_2"/"Ni)(to)C_6H_5NH_2`
(v) Electrolytic Reduction : When nitro benzene is reduced electrolytically in presence of concentrated sulphuric acid, phenyl hydroxylamine is first produced which rearranges to give p-amino phenol.
